Selecting the Right Coffee Beans
Choosing beans is the heart of the hamper. Look for:
- Single-origin roasts – They offer distinct flavor profiles that tell a story. Medium to dark roasts – These are generally more forgiving and appeal to a broader audience. Freshness – Aim for beans roasted within the last 14 days; freshness is key to flavor.
Remember, the beans should be the centerpiece. If you’re unsure, a classic French roast or a Colombian medium roast is a safe bet that satisfies most taste buds.

Budget‑Friendly Options Without Compromise
You don’t need to break the bank to give a memorable gift. Here’s how to keep costs down while still impressing:

- Buy in bulk – Many roasters offer discounts for larger orders, especially if you’re ordering a single type of bean. DIY extras – Instead of buying a fancy mug, consider a stylish travel mug you already own. Seasonal sales – Look for promotions during holidays or coffee festivals. Local roasters – Often cheaper than international brands and support the community.
